:DELAy[1|2]:STOP
{NONE|<V|>V|=V|<C|>C|=C|<P|>P|=P}[,<v
alue>]
Sets the stop condition of delay.
NONE: Sets stop condition type as “NONE”.
<V, >V,=V: Sets stop condition type as “<voltage”
“>voltage” “=voltage”.
<C,>C, =C: Sets stop condition type as “<current”
“>current” “=current”.
<P,>P, =P: Sets stop condition type as “<power”
“>power” “=power”.
<value> It is used to set voltage, current or power
value of stop condition, which range from 0 to the
maximum voltage/current/power value of the
active channel.
:DELAy2:STOP >V,8
Sets the stop condition of delay as >8V for CH2.
